The automatic powder machine is a mechatronics equipment that integrateswith powdering and baking tube, which can coat phosphor for spiralenergy-saving lamps. Because there are many shortcomings in the old-fashionedpowder machine, such as covering large area, high equipment cost,non-uniformity besmear powder, wasting materials, environmental pollution andso on, a new type of automated powder equipment is needed to overcomethese shortcomings in the market. Based on a Hangzhou company's R&Dprojects, the main task in this paper is to design and develop a new automaticpowder machine to achieve energy-saving lamps automated powder coating andsome specific function. The device proposed not only has features of smallfootprint, saving material, coating powder evenly, production environmentalprotection, better quality and lower cost, but also greatly reduces the costs ofproduction by using the embedded ARM9control scheme.In this paper,the main work are as follows:1. The structure, electrical system, process of powder coating andtechnology implementation in the existing automatic powder machinemechanical are analyzed, and the deficiencies of the existing equipment are got.According to the analysis of the obtained data, the control parameters andcertain functions needed to achieve in the new equipment are designed.2. According to the project design goal of automatic powder machine, theembedded-control scheme based on ARM9processor core is studied and putforward, and the details of hardware design of control system are given.3. The LCD display drivers, touch screen drive, CAN bus communication,stepping motor drive, and sensor data acquisition and analysis are finished,andcorresponding code in the serial RS-232communications is compiled based onthe LPC2919platform.4. According to the analysis results of the existing equipment and the actualneed of the project, the software design of the control system based on the driveprogram is implemented. And it includes the user module, the date settings module, the decryption module, the interface prompts module,120motor statecontrol, data acquisition and processing, machine unlock processing and chipencryption processing part, etc.5. Through the hardware debug, software debug for system and the wholeequipment debug, the initial design target is achieved and the product batchproduction is realized, which is favored by the users.
